Who We Are
Today, Child Advocacy Centers are widely recognized as the standard for investigating and treating childhood sexual abuse. Without a Child Advocacy Center, children are subjected to multiple interviews, families are left to navigate a confusing, fragmented child protection system, and child abuse professionals lack the coordinated system critical to ensure children receive the intervention and care tailored to each child's unique circumstances.
Incorporated in 2004, Pat's Place is a non-profit 501(c)3 corporation and is one of just over 700 centers nationwide and 29 centers in North Carolina accredited by the National Children's Alliance. Since inception, Pat's Place has assisted over 1,600 children affected by sexual abuse throughout Mecklenburg County.
Serving children from birth to age 18, Pat's Place offers a coordinated continuum of services through a neutral, child-friendly facility. Within this facility, child abuse professionals interview, medically examine, and provide treatment services ensuring the child and their family are safe and supported during the process of evaluating sexual abuse. At Pat's Place, our focus is to help sexually abused children by:
- Increasing the effectiveness of services to child abuse victims
- Reducing the child abuse victim's trauma and expediting recovery
- Preventing further abuse
